Kitley House Hotel, an upmarket hotel in Devon, has been placed into administration, after being hit by sluggish trading.
Christopher Norman and Ian Walker from Begbies Traynor have been brought in to the hotel, which trades from a grade 1 listed building with a 500-year history in Yealmpton, near Plymouth in South Devon. It is to continue trading while a buyer is sought to save the hotel and the future of its 40-strong workforce.
The property is a popular wedding and celebration venue, and its gardens are listed as a Devon County Wildlife Site.
Joint administrator Ian Walker commented on the situation to This is Plymouth, “This is a fine hotel with a great deal of potential as well as a good reputation in the luxury hotel market. We will be working extremely hard to find a buyer for the business so that it can continue to serve guests and contribute to the south west’s economy.”
Any customers who have paid their deposits to the hotel are to make contact with the business and all efforts will be made to honour bookings.
The hotel features its own shooting estate, a restaurant and bar, nearby golf courses, and is well located for established walking routes.
